Trinseo Celebrates 30th Anniversary of Hamina Manufacturing Plant

Trinseo (NYSE: TSE) a global materials solutions provider and manufacturer of plastics, latex binders and synthetic rubber, celebrated the 30th anniversary of its latex production plant in Hamina, Finland. The event was shared by employees and their families concluding with a final celebration at Hamina Tattoo International Military Music Festival.

Founded in 1988, Hamina latex binders manufacturing plant provides customers with a broad line of products for paper and board, carpet and textiles, as well as the performance latex market.

Trinseo’s Hamina latex binders production plant expects continued growth due to its unique latex heritage and renowned industry leadership in the region. It is able to produce and deliver products for a wide variety of industries, including adhesives, construction, and functional nonwovens, and has been positioned itself as strategic partner for its customers.

“On behalf of the entire Trinseo team, we are proud to celebrate the 30th anniversary of the Hamina facility taking a leadership role in the region by bringing high reliability and flexibility to the market,” said Paavo Rönkkö, Site and Production Leader. “We believe our strong track record in the production of innovative latex binder solutions coupled with our customer centricity makes us a strong partner to meet the needs of our customers.”

The anniversary celebration coincided with Hamina Tattoo, an internationally renowned military music festival that is sponsored in part by Trinseo since 1990. Hamina plant employees and customers took part in a special recognition at the festival.
